Understanding AML Compliance

Anti-Money Laundering (AML) compliance is a critical component of financial regulations designed to prevent the illegal concealment of money. Institutions must adhere to a set of procedures to identify and report suspicious financial activities. Key components of AML compliance include:

  • Know Your Customer (KYC): Verifying the identity of clients before allowing transactions.
  • Transaction Monitoring: Continuously tracking financial activities to detect suspicious patterns.
  • Suspicious Activity Reports (SARs): Reporting anomalies to regulatory bodies for further investigation.
  • Record Keeping: Maintaining detailed logs for auditing and regulatory purposes.

While these practices are essential, traditional AML infrastructure often faces challenges like fragmented data systems, slow information sharing, and difficulty tracking transactions across global networks. Blockchain’s unique properties can address these issues by providing a more secure, transparent, and efficient solution.

How Blockchain Enhances AML Compliance

1.      Decentralized Transparency

One of the most powerful features of blockchain is its decentralized and immutable ledger. Transactions recorded on a blockchain are time-stamped, encrypted, and visible to all participants in the network. This transparency creates a permanent, auditable trail of all financial transactions, making it significantly more difficult for criminals to obscure the origins of illicit funds.

Blockchain’s transparency ensures that authorities and financial institutions can trace the movement of money in real-time or retrospectively. This level of traceability adds a layer of security, making it harder for money laundering activities to go undetected.

2.      Real-Time Monitoring and Alerts

Traditional AML systems often rely on post-transaction monitoring, which means they are reactive rather than proactive. Blockchain allows for real-time transaction monitoring, enabling institutions to spot suspicious activity before significant damage is done.

With the use of smart contracts—self-executing code embedded within the blockchain—institutions can automate the monitoring process. For example, if a transaction exceeds a certain threshold or originates from a flagged address, the smart contract can automatically block it or trigger an alert to compliance officers. This automated system enhances the speed and accuracy of detecting potentially illicit activities.

3.      Streamlined KYC and Shared Identity Systems

KYC processes are essential but can often be time-consuming, costly, and repetitive for both financial institutions and customers. Each bank must verify a customer’s identity, conduct due diligence, and store sensitive personal data separately, leading to inefficiencies.

Blockchain provides a solution by enabling secure, permissioned identity sharing. Once a customer’s identity is verified and recorded on the blockchain, it can be shared across multiple financial institutions with the customer’s consent. This reduces redundancy, speeds up the onboarding process, and lowers compliance costs, all while preserving data integrity and user privacy.

4.      Enhanced Traceability

Every transaction on the blockchain is associated with a unique cryptographic signature, making it possible to trace funds back to their original source. This feature is particularly valuable in uncovering complex money laundering schemes that often involve multiple transactions across different institutions and borders.

Unlike traditional systems, which are often fragmented and siloed, blockchain offers a unified view of the flow of funds. This makes it easier for investigators to follow the money trail, whether it’s to catch criminals or to verify the legitimacy of transactions.

5.      Improved Data Security

Blockchain uses advanced cryptographic techniques to secure data. Unlike centralized databases, which are vulnerable to cyberattacks and single points of failure, blockchain’s distributed architecture ensures that data remains secure even if one part of the system is compromised.

This enhanced security is crucial in AML compliance, where financial institutions are tasked with safeguarding sensitive customer data. Blockchain provides a more robust defense against data breaches, ensuring that personal and financial information is kept safe from unauthorized access.

Challenges and Limitations

While blockchain has significant potential to transform AML compliance, there are several challenges and limitations that must be addressed:

1.      Pseudonymity vs. Anonymity

Public blockchains like Bitcoin and Ethereum offer pseudonymity, where identification of users is by wallet addresses rather than their real names. Although all transactions are visible, linking these addresses to actual identities can be difficult without additional tools or information. This opens a potential loophole for criminals to launder money anonymously unless identity mapping is in place.

2.      Regulatory Uncertainty

Blockchain technology is evolving faster than the regulatory frameworks that govern it. There is currently no global consensus on how to regulate blockchain-based financial systems, leading to legal uncertainty for institutions looking to implement it for AML purposes.

Some countries have adopted blockchain-friendly regulations, while others have imposed restrictions or outright bans. This regulatory inconsistency can complicate cross-border AML efforts and may deter institutions from fully adopting blockchain-based solutions.

3.      Integration with Legacy Systems

Many financial institutions still rely on outdated legacy systems that are not compatible with blockchain infrastructure. Transitioning to blockchain-based solutions requires significant investment, technical expertise, and operational changes. Interoperability between blockchain platforms and traditional databases remains a work in progress.

4.      Data Privacy and GDPR

Storing sensitive customer data on a blockchain, even in encrypted form, can present privacy concerns. For example, under the General Data Protection Regulation (GDPR), individuals have the right to request the deletion of their personal data—something that conflicts with blockchain’s immutable nature.

To address this, many developers are exploring hybrid blockchain models or off-chain data storage solutions that allow storage of sensitive data externally while retaining proof and references on the blockchain.

The Future of Blockchain in AML

Despite its challenges, blockchain’s potential to revolutionize AML compliance remains significant. As the technology matures and regulatory frameworks adapt, we can expect more widespread adoption of blockchain solutions across the financial industry. Some key developments on the horizon include:

  • Regtech Innovation: Startups focused on regulatory technology (Regtech) are leveraging blockchain to build more agile and cost-effective compliance tools.
  • Central Bank Digital Currencies (CBDCs): As governments explore the development of CBDCs, blockchain-based AML protocols may become standard.
  • Global Collaboration: Efforts to standardize blockchain regulations and share AML intelligence across borders will strengthen cross-border compliance.
  • AI + Blockchain: The integration of blockchain’s data integrity with AI’s pattern recognition capabilities could provide powerful new tools for detecting and preventing money laundering.
